Annuities are a sort of financial investment item that is typically utilized for retirement preparation. They can be called contracts that offer repayments to a private, for either a certain amount of time, or the remainder of your life. In straightforward terms, you will certainly spend either an one-time repayment, or smaller sized constant repayments, and in exchange, you will get payments based upon the quantity you spent, plus your returns.
The rate of return is established at the start of your agreement and will certainly not be influenced by market fluctuations. A set annuity is an excellent choice for someone trying to find a secure and predictable income. Variable Annuities Variable annuities are annuities that permit you to invest your costs into a selection of options like bonds, stocks, or shared funds.
While this implies that variable annuities have the potential to supply greater returns compared to dealt with annuities, it likewise indicates your return price can fluctuate. You may have the ability to make more revenue in this situation, however you additionally risk of potentially losing money. Fixed-Indexed Annuities Fixed-indexed annuities, likewise referred to as equity-indexed annuities, integrate both taken care of and variable functions.
This offers a fixed degree of earnings, in addition to the possibility to make extra returns based on various other investments. While this usually secures you versus shedding earnings, it also limits the profits you may be able to make. This kind of annuity is a terrific alternative for those looking for some protection, and the potential for high profits.
These financiers purchase shares in the fund, and the fund spends the money, based upon its specified purpose. Mutual funds consist of choices in significant property courses such as equities (supplies), fixed-income (bonds) and cash market safety and securities. Financiers share in the gains or losses of the fund, and returns are not assured.
Financiers in annuities shift the risk of running out of money to the insurance coverage firm. Annuities are usually much more expensive than common funds since of this function.
Both mutual funds and annuity accounts use you a range of options for your retired life financial savings requires. But investing for retired life is only one part of preparing for your monetary future it's just as vital to figure out how you will certainly obtain revenue in retired life. Annuities typically supply a lot more choices when it involves acquiring this income.
You can take lump-sum or systematic withdrawals, or pick from the following earnings choices: Single-life annuity: Offers regular benefit payments for the life of the annuity proprietor. Joint-life annuity: Offers normal advantage settlements for the life of the annuity owner and a companion. Fixed-period annuity: Pays revenue for a specified variety of years.
Partial annuitization: An approach whereby you annuitize a part of your account equilibrium to generate revenue. The balance continues to be invested up until a later date. Choosing which investment alternatives might be best for you relies on your special monetary situation and your retirement revenue objectives. Obtain quick solutions to your annuity concerns: Call 800-872-6684 (9-5 EST) What is the distinction in between a dealt with annuity and a variable annuity? Set annuities pay the exact same quantity every month, while variable annuities pay a quantity that relies on the financial investment efficiency of the financial investments held by the certain annuity.
Why would certainly you desire an annuity? Tax-Advantaged Investing: When funds are invested in an annuity (within a retired life strategy, or not) growth of resources, dividends and interest are all tax obligation deferred. Investments into annuities can be either tax obligation insurance deductible or non-tax deductible contributions depending on whether the annuity is within a retirement or otherwise.
Distributions from annuities spent for by tax obligation deductible payments are totally taxable at the recipient's after that existing income tax obligation rate. Circulations from annuities paid for by non-tax deductible funds are subject to special therapy due to the fact that a few of the periodic repayment is really a return of funding spent and this is not taxed, just the rate of interest or investment gain portion is taxed at the recipient's then present earnings tax price.
